blockly > FieldCheckbox > (コンストラクタ)

FieldCheckbox.(constructor)

FieldCheckbox クラスの新しいインスタンスを作成します。

署名:

constructor(value?: CheckboxBool | typeof Field.SKIP_SETUP, validator?: FieldCheckboxValidator, config?: FieldCheckboxConfig);

パラメータ

パラメータ 種類 説明
value CheckboxBool | typeof Field.SKIP_SETUP (省略可)フィールドの初期値。TRUE、FALSE、ブール値のいずれかを指定してください。デフォルトは「FALSE」です。設定をスキップする場合、Field.SKIP_SETUP も受け入れます(構成を処理し、独自のコンストラクタが実行された後にフィールド値を設定するサブクラスでのみ使用されます)。
validator FieldCheckboxValidator (省略可)フィールドの値の変更を検証するために呼び出される関数。値 ('TRUE' または 'FALSE') を取り、検証された値 ('TRUE' または 'FALSE') を返すか、null 値を返して変更を中止します。
config FieldCheckboxConfig (省略可)フィールドの構成に使用するオプションのマップ。このパラメータがサポートするプロパティのリストについては、[フィールド作成のドキュメント]https://developers.google.com/blockly/guides/create-custom-blocks/fields/built-in-fields/checkbox#creation をご覧ください。